The Big Release Date Question

So, the million-dollar question. The one that’s probably spawned a million fan theories and a thousand frantic Google searches. What’s the deal with the Euphoria Season 3 release date?

Here's the tea, and it’s a little… lukewarm. As of right now, we don’t have a concrete, locked-in, "mark your calendars in permanent marker" release date. Nope. Nada. Zilch. It’s a bit of a mystery, isn’t it?

But don’t despair! We’re not totally in the dark. We’ve got some intel. Think of it as breadcrumbs, leading us closer to the promised land of new Euphoria episodes.

What We Do Know (So Far!)

Okay, so the big news is that Season 3 is happening. Phew! Take a deep breath, my friends. We can exhale now. The powers that be have confirmed it. It’s official. No take-backsies.

And, get this, the writing is reportedly already underway. That’s right, the scribes are locked away, presumably fueled by coffee and existential angst, crafting the next chapter of our favorite messed-up characters.

This is good news, right? It means they’re actively working on it. They’re not just… sitting on it, letting it gather dust like that forgotten diary in Nate Jacobs’ room. (Shudder.)

Why the Wait? (The Eternal Question)

Okay, so why the heck is it taking so long? Is Sam Levinson just chilling on a beach somewhere, manifesting plotlines in the sand? Is Zendaya busy saving the world, one superhero landing at a time?

Well, it’s a few things, really. And honestly, some of them are pretty understandable, even if they do make us gnash our teeth a little.

First off, and this is a biggie, scheduling. These actors are in high demand. Like, seriously high demand. Zendaya, obviously, is a global superstar. Sydney Sweeney is everywhere. Hunter Schafer is iconic. You get the picture. They’ve got other projects, other dreams to chase, other red carpets to walk.

And it’s not just the big names. The entire ensemble cast is packed with talent. Getting everyone’s schedules to align for months of grueling filming? It’s like trying to get all your friends to agree on a restaurant. Almost impossible.

Then there’s the creative process. Sam Levinson is known for his… unique vision. He’s not just churning out episodes like a factory. He’s crafting an experience. And that takes time. It takes agonizing over every single shot, every single line, every single moment of existential dread. (You know, the good stuff.)

Plus, let’s be real, Euphoria isn’t exactly a slapstick comedy. It deals with some pretty heavy stuff. And making sure that is handled with the care and nuance it deserves? That requires thoughtfulness. And time. So, so much time.

And finally, and this is just my theory, but it feels like there’s a pressure to live up to expectations. Season 2 left us all reeling, didn't it? The stakes are higher than ever. They’ve got to deliver something that’s not just good, but great. Something that makes us forget the agonizing wait.
